Muskegon Heights Middle School (Closed 2015)

55 East Sherman Blvd
Muskegon, MI 49444
Serving 205 students in grades 6-8, Muskegon Heights Middle School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Michigan for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math was 8% (which was lower than the Michigan state average of 41%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ts was 22% (which was lower than the Michigan state average of 67%).
The student:teacher ratio of 10:1 was lower than the Michigan state level of 17:1.
Minority enrollment was 98% of the student body (majority Black), which was higher than the Michigan state average of 37% (majority Black).
